When I play games on PC, I have this constant worry that the game will crash and hours of play and progress will have gone to waste.

I think consoles are the better when it comes to games although the PC has always had the edge when it comes to the online option. Now that consoles are getting online capabilities it shouldn't be long before they finally have the larger appeal over PC.

Consoles such as the Dreamcast only really offered 4 player games online though, so there wasn't a great deal of difference between playing online and having friends over, besides the variety of competition of course.

The X-Box however offers games where a lot more players will be able to work together or battle. The best thing about online gaming in my opinion on PC is the fact you can have large teams of players battling in clans, etc.

Now that the X-Box has brought this to the console world, things can only get better as far as online gaming on consoles goes. I think consoles are more reliable than PC's when it comes to games. Yes occasionally you might get unlucky and a game will crash, but its a rare event compared to the PC.

There are games on PC that I'd love to see come to consoles, especially the likes of strategy games such as Red Alert 2. It would be nice to see certain peripherals come out for consoles too. For strategy games on PC you can purchase a mouse that has several buttons for you to navigate around the game with minimal use of a keyboard (think one is called the commander or something).

Anyway overall, I tend to stick to consoles for games. But at the same time, PC's still have that area where consoles are lacking until Microsoft can hopefully change this.
